Walmart, Sam’s Club to assist with hurricane relief efforts

9/17/2018
In the wake of Hurricane Florence, Walmart and Sam’s Club have announced their efforts in helping those affected by the storm.

The Bentonville, Ark.-based retailer is launching a customer campaign to assist communities impacted, and as part of the Walmart 2018 Relief Fund, the company will match customer donations with 2-to-1 cash donations up to $5 million.

“Our associates and friends have been significantly impacted by this devastating storm,” Dan Bartlett, executive vice president of corporate affairs for Walmart, said. “We’ve seen over the years that our customers all across the country stand ready to help their fellow citizens when mother nature hits. So we’re proud to provide a way to support their generosity during this great time of need.”

Customers can make their donation online or at Walmart and Sam’s Club registers. Each donation will be sent to the Walmart 2018 Hurricane Relief Fund at Foundation for the Carolinas and will support organizations providing such relief efforts as shelter, food, comfort and emergency assistance.

In addition, the company is looking to support associates who have been impacted by the storm with disaster-support assistance, support centers in impacted areas, providing hot meals to families and calling associates to conduct wellness checks.

Walmart and Sam’s Club pharmacies also will be open as long as conditions are safe for customers and associates, and will deploy a mobile pharmacy to impacted areas to provide prescriptions, immunizations and general resources.
